Wood window services typically involve repairs, restorations, and maintenance for wooden window frames and sashes. These services aim to address issues such as rotting wood, cracked or damaged frames, and deteriorating paint or finishes. Professionals may also assist with reglazing, replacing broken panes, and restoring the structural integrity of wooden windows to ensure they function properly and maintain their aesthetic appeal. Proper care and repair can extend the lifespan of wooden windows, preserving their charm and value for years to come.
Many common problems that wood window services help resolve include water damage, warping, and drafts caused by gaps or deteriorated seals. Over time, exposure to the elements can lead to wood decay, which may compromise the window’s stability and insulation properties. Service providers can perform necessary repairs to prevent further damage, improve energy efficiency, and restore the window’s appearance. Regular maintenance and timely interventions can also prevent costly replacements and keep windows operating smoothly.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Simsbury,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ically costs between $500 and $1,200 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ard single-hung window may fall closer to $600, while larger or custom designs can exceed $1,000.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ows can range from $150 to $600 per window, with common issues like rotting or damaged frames falling within this range. Minor fixes such as sash or hardware repairs tend to be on the lower end.
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ring wood windows through sanding, staining, or painting generally costs between $200 and $800 per window. The cost varies based on the extent of work and the window's size and condition.
Installation Fees - Professional installation of new wood windows usually ranges from $300 to $700 per window. Factors influencing the cost include the window type, complexity of installation, and local labor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
